No person, as defined in Article I, shall provide commercial transport of solid waste, including recyclable materials, through the streets or public places of the City without the written authorization of a New Jersey Department of Environmental Protection, Division of Solid Waste permit, and when such permit is granted, it shall be upon the condition that the same shall be transported in vehicles or receptacles that shall be covered and watertight so that no odor or liquid shall escape therefrom.
A. 
It shall be unlawful for solid waste collectors to collect solid waste that is mixed with, or contains visible signs of, designated recyclable materials. It shall also be unlawful for solid waste collectors to remove for disposal those bags or containers of solid waste that visibly display a warning notice sticker or some other device indicating that the load of solid waste contains designated recyclable materials.
B. 
It shall be the responsibility of the resident or occupant to properly segregate the uncollected solid waste for proper disposal or recycling. Allowing such unseparated solid waste and recyclables to accumulate will be considered a violation of this chapter and the local sanitary code.
C. 
Once placed for collection in the location identified by this chapter, or any rules or regulations promulgated pursuant to this chapter, no person, other than those authorized by the City, shall tamper with, collect, remove, or otherwise handle eligible solid waste or designated recyclable materials. Any such action in violation hereof from one or more residences shall constitute a separate and distinct offense punishable as hereinafter provided.
